After the success of Phantom and Summertime at the last Tempo concert - finding music for the MetroNomes to grow and develop their playing and ensemble skills has been challenging. However - I think we have it!
Feeling Good - made famous by Michael Buble and one of my favourite versions by Muse has proved to be so much fun after the initial run through today. There are a few things I need to check on the parts, but after the initial confusion over the 12/8 time signature (not so much the notes but the rests that trip you up here) we were able to make it sound amazing!
We have a new member too! Kimberly Jones on piano has enabled Annabelle to jump on a sax (that makes 2 sax parts!!) So our lineup at the moment consists of 1 cornet, 2 sax (1 clarinet returning) 2 violins, electric bass, piano and drums.
The next piece was revealed today to an enthusiastic response (and impromptu singing) so watch out Tempo! We're on our way to having the most amazing set list.
Looking forward to seeing what we can do!
